The magisterial graphic novel of the Book of Esther, now back in an enhanced edition.

For more than twenty years, JT Waldman's Megillat Esther has remained the gold standard for what an illustrated book of the Bible can be. Long out of print, this new full-color edition enhances the black-and-white original and brings Waldman's vision to a new generation of readers—featuring both English and Hebrew.

Across more than 150 gorgeous pages, Waldman brings the story of Purim to life in illustrations that will impress kids and adults alike. At turns provocative and mysterious, Megillat Esther brings emotional brilliance to this age-old story, interspersing its narrative with a hidden backstory. Never before or since has a book of the Bible been illustrated with such grandeur and beauty. This expanded edition adds new layers of delight and depth to each and every page.

Megillat Esther: The Graphic Tale was published by Print-O-Craft and is distributed by Ayin Press (via Publishers Group West).
